2. Role Summary

As our Administration Assistant, you will be responsible for coordinating day‑to‑day operational and administrative activities across the organisation:

  • Working closely with the Executive Support Coordinator, Senior Management Team, Board of Directors, and wider staff
  • You’ll support in the management of meetings, maintain systems and support reporting. This role is varied, collaborative, and central to creating a well‑organised and inclusive working environment.
  • To provide general administrative assistant to the team.
  • To support the wider team in overseeing the office maintenance, upkeep of office equipment and supplies as appropriate.
  • To support in the coordination and administration of internal team meetings
  • Support in the administration required for Board meetings and support in the regular updating of policies and procedures.
  • To effectively use Microsoft Office packages to produce letters, reports, minutes, update spreadsheets and other documents as required.
  • Administration to support Financial Management and reporting.
